Job Description

Purpose

The Statutory Accounting Lead is responsible for the timeliness and accuracy of the local statutory and tax compliance requirements for the countries supported. This position is the liaison with the external auditors and the Affiliates by coordinating all statutory requests during the audits, including providing information, preparing the financial statements, and answering technical questions. This colleague must possess a solid technical accounting knowledge of the local requirements.

Responsibilities

  • Prepare the statutory financial statements, including the related disclosures.

  • Review the US GAAP monthly closing process to prepare adjustments for local books.

  • Maintain Balance Sheet reconciliations for statutory GL accounts.

  • Interpretate and roll out of local accounting policy/technical standards.

  • Coordinate the statutory audits and manage the audit schedule.

  • Prepare the local tax provision calculation.

  • Support tax COE in primary and secondary filings and manage accounting for taxes.
